If I lose weight after breast lift with implants, will it affect my results? Will they sag again?

March 29, 2017
Asked By:Myy.lady in Los Angeles, CA

scheduled for surgery on april 5 im 135 goal is 115 pounds my question is if i lose that weight will it affect my breast alot to the point were they sag again and need a new surgery? I've lost about 50 pounds up until now but my breast never changed size maybe they did sagged a little more but since i can remember they were always saggy. Will 20-25 pounds affect my results? I talked to my ps and he said yes but that i wasn't going to lose too much weight to the point that i look like a skeleton
